Mid-Length
Mid-Length or hybrid boards, which serve as a middle ground between downwind boards and smaller, more performance-oriented boards. Hybrids are often shorter and wider than downwind boards, but still retain some of the efficiency needed for light to moderate wind conditions. They are well-suited for riders who regularly get out in 12-20 knot winds. Hybrid boards are more versatile, offering decent performance in both light wind and wave conditions, while also being able to handle more wind when it picks up. However, hybrids require slightly more skill to get up on foil than downwind boards.
